Jesselyn Silva in JessZilla

Festival & Awards

  • In competition at IDFA, Big Sky, DOC NYC, Atlanta and Hot Springs
  • Best Picture, Best Director, Best Documentary Feature at Fargo Film Festival
  • Special Jury Mention, Documentary Feature, Atlanta Film Festival
  • Outstanding Documentary Feature, Ridgefield Film Festival
  • Best Cinematography, Flickers Rhode Island International
  • Selected for the inaugural Popcorn List and the American Film Showcase
  • Nominated at Slamdance Indie Awards, Shine Global's Resilience Awards, FilmThreat's AwardThis! and Next Generation Indie Film Awards

Distribution & Reach

  • Mainstream distribution through Monkey Wrench Films, covering VOD and AVOD on 15+ platforms across 10+ countries
  • Educational distribution through festivals and school screenings, several for an additional screening fee
  • Organic social posts from Mike Tyson, Laila Ali, Claressa Shields, Gervonta Davis and Edgar Berlanga
  • Children across the country wrote letters to Jesselyn after seeing the film

Impact & Partnerships

  • Named fund with CURE Childhood Cancer and the World Boxing Council, raising over $50,000 for two DIPG/DMG research projects
  • Funded research identified the enzyme PHGDH that these tumours rely on. A new drug blocked it, tumours shrank, treated mice lived significantly longer
  • The WBC's “Gray in May” belt presented at Inoue vs. Cardenas in Las Vegas for Brain Cancer Awareness Month
  • Pedro flown to Bangkok, honoured with the WBC's “Bravest Man on Earth” award
  • An ATHENTOR × WBC boxing club taking shape in Thailand in Jesselyn's name

Puzzle People

Acquired and distributed by Switchboard Magazine, then extended into a series through a creative distribution partnership with the Hello, Puzzlers! podcast, fiscally sponsored through Film Independent.

  • Festival run at 25+ festivals
  • Hot Springs Audience Award · Aspen Shorts Jury Award
  • Berkshire International FF “Next Great Filmmaker” Award
  • Telly Award Silver Winner · 1.4 Awards Finalist
  • Project Unlonely Jury Award · Vimeo Staff Pick
  • Licensing fees from REFRAME at Vimeo, Video Consortium and 41 North
  • Over 15,000 views across the series
